some kinds of seismic waves cannot travel through liquids, such as the outer core.
Scientists have inferred the presence of a liquid outer core through various indirect measurements and observations. One main line of evidence comes from studying the behavior of seismic waves during earthquakes, which indicates that the outer core is liquid. Additionally, the Earth's magnetic field suggests the presence of a rotating liquid metal outer core.

The Earth's magnetic field is the result of electric currents in the liquid metal outer core.The outer core of the Earth is over 2,000 km thick. It sits above the solid inner core and is composed of highly conducting liquid iron and nickel. Above the outer core is the Earth's mantle.The geodynamo is the mechanism thought to be responsible for the electric current in the core and the generation of the Earth's magnetic field through the convection of conducting fluids in the Earth's core. This is because the Outer Core is liquid, and we know from experiments that S-waves cannot travel through liquids. If they could pass through the outer core, they could pass through the Inner, but they are absorbed by the first barrier, at the Gutenberg Discontinuity.
